Leciester City star Maddison's struggling form doesn't concern Rodgers

Leicester City manager Brendan Rodgers thinks James Maddison will have no problems regaining the “really high level” he’s played at consistently this season.

Maddison and the Foxes have had an uneven start to 2020 after getting out of the blocks quickly when the season started. They’re still in third place in the table, two points clear of fourth placed Chelsea.

They face 18th placed Aston Villa on Monday and Maddison will be in an intriguing personal duel with Jack Grealish, a rival for a spot in Gareth Southgate’s England squad for the European Championships in the summer.
